Stores | Carrefour Group The Carrefour hypermarket format is designed for major shopping trips: a mix of 20,000 to 80,000 products in a sales area ranging from 2,400 to 23,000m2 On site, customers can get fresh products prepared every day by our artisans and practical services (banking and insurance, for example) at competitive prices
Carrefour - Wikipedia Carrefour Group, S A (French: Groupe Carrefour, ⓘ), is a French multinational retail and wholesaling corporation headquartered in Massy, France It operates a chain of hypermarkets, grocery stores and convenience stores By 2024, the group had 14,000 stores in 40 countries [1] It is the seventh-largest retailer in the world by revenue

Carrefour SA | Retail, Supermarkets, Hypermarkets | Britannica Money Carrefour SA, French company that is one of the world’s largest retailers Headquarters are in Paris Carrefour operates thousands of stores under various names, including the hypermarket Carrefour, the supermarket Champion, convenience stores Shopi and Marché Plus, discount stores Dia and Ed, and the cash-and-carry store Promocash, in dozens of countries around the world
History | Carrefour Group 2018: Alexandre Bompard presents the “Carrefour 2022” transformation plan With food transition at the heart of its transformation plan, Carrefour launches “Act for Food” - a specific action programme to make eating better more affordable - and deploys blockchain technology for the first time (Carrefour Quality Line Poulet d’Auvergne Chicken)
